EVERY STREET BUT OURS — Drama Screenplay
Elizabeth Ashworth is the last kind of person the Germans would suspect of harboring one of their officers, which is exactly why she becomes the perfect collaborator when Captain Karl Von Stern is carried unconscious into her ballroom. He offers her intelligence in exchange for his life. His predictions are terrifyingly precise, and hundreds are saved because of them. Then she realizes the warnings are not memories of briefings he attended. They are something else entirely, and every street he saves is another street across the city that he condemns.
London, 1941. A duchess turns her Mayfair mansion into a hospital for the Blitz. One of her patients is a wounded Luftwaffe captain. His warnings about the next raid keep coming true, and she is about to learn why.
